The rules of lacing are there to protect you, so many people know the dangers of tightlacing and if you dont comply you can seriously damage yourself.

However, if you are just wearing one of those cheapo corsets from somewhere like Ann Summers or off Ebay, then no rules, just put it on and go.... They are just a fashionable outer upper garment and you shouldnt lace them up too tightly (probably only go in 1 inch less than your natural waist measurement no more).

They are marketed as a 'corset' but are basques that have been made to look like one.

The boning in them is cheap and flexible (usually made of plastic or cheap metal) and if you try to tightlace you can cause damage to your back and internal organs as well as the 'corset'.

If, however you decide you want to go for a cinched waist and tightlace we will discuss retailers to purchase them from and also how to safely lace on the weekend.

Most women think all you do is get into any 'corset' then pull the laces as tightly as you can get them!!

Personally, I dont like any of the non made to measure corsets, I find them inferior quality and not as comfortable.

01-09-09, 11:34 AM
Bad hon!

Because tightlacing is a body modification, your waist will change shape...so therefore when your waist becomes more pliable and smaller your corset will no longer give you the required support and the distribution of pressure will be uneven causing areas which will be tighter and areas which will be loose (kind of like using thin strips of plaster to support something, if you do one strip tighter than the others it do more harm than good).

Ive tried Vollers and I must be honest, I wasnt impressed, I sent it back :(

For almost the same price you can get a made to measure...I will pm you the details...the lady who makes them is a genius!

I mean dont get me wrong, there is nothing wrong with High Street brands but if you intend on tightlacing then it becomes like the biking equivalent of...do I buy a cheap lid or a decent one to protect my head. If you are going to start tightlacing ie: 4 inches or more of reduction over a period of time, the damage you can cause will outweigh the cheap cost of a corset that will crush you where you shouldnt be crushed.

No offence taken Fizz,
Ok you can wear an exterior corset as a fashion accessory, you can wear one that is just a 'pretty' which means you cant lace in much and if you dont have much of a waist to start with you wont have much in the 'corset'

There are others that pull you in and give you a cute little waist. I go for the pin up look eg: Betty Page, Bernie Dexter etc. I love the traditional 40s type dress to go with it, it involves some 'proper corsets' and a degree of tightlacing.
You can go down about 4 inches off your natural waist to get that nipped in look. You will get to the stage where your waist is trained and your corset is too large then you have to move on and get another one....if you want to that is..

Extreme tightlacers go far beyond this point, corsetting down to mere 15 inch waists and it looks horrible, I would never get to this stage, I will not go lower than 22 inches corsetted.
They also wear them 23 hours a day, which for me would be impractical.

My corsetting is a side effect (as it may be) of my love of the 40s pin up girls and fashion, I would not consider it as something I would do around the house or wear to bed (......to sleep that is ;) )

Thats why it sounds dangerous...tightlacing is a lifetime work, you can only start at corsetting down a max of 2 inches from your natural waist...when your waist trains down then you do another 2..the horrible picture above, she is 70 years odd and has been doing this for many decades.

I do not extreme tightlace....that is for experts.
